IN THE HIGH COURT OF PUNJAB AND HARYANA

AT CHANDIGARH CRM-M-45698 of 2016 Date of Decision: 10.09.2018 Gagandeep Kaur and others ....Petitioners

Versus

State of Punjab and others ....Respondents CORAM: HON'BLE MR. JUSTICE RAMENDRA JAIN Present: - None for the petitioners.

Mr. Harpreet Multani, AAG, Punjab.

RAMENDRA JAIN, J. (ORAL) Learned State counsel, on instructions from ASI Amrik Singh, submits that this petition has rendered infructuous as all the prosecution witnesses have been examined and the case is fixed for defence evidence for 21.09.2018. Perusal of file shows that on the previous date also none was present on behalf of the petitioners. Even today no one has appeared on their behalf. Therefore, it can safely be presumed that petitioners or their counsel are no more interested in pursuing this petition.

Dismissed as having rendered infructuous and for want of prosecution as well.

(Ramendra Jain) September 10, 2018 Judge R.S.
